It’s been a bad past few weeks for IKEA, to say the least.

After recalling roughly 29 million dressers responsible for fatal accidents involving three children, IKEA is now recalling 80,000 “Patrull” safety gates that have injured children due to the locking mechanism opening unexpectedly.

All in all, IKEA has received 55 incident reports, from cuts and bruises to concussions.

If you happen to have bought one of IKEA’s dumb safety gates, the company is offering full refunds to its customers.
